What resources are available for financial education?
South Florida Educational Federal Credit Union offers a variety of resources aimed at enhancing financial literacy. These resources are designed to assist members in understanding crucial financial concepts, making informed decisions, and ultimately achieving their financial goals. One prominent resource is the educational content available on their official website, where members can find articles, guides, and tools covering a wide range of topics such as budgeting, saving, credit management, loans, and retirement planning.
Additionally, South Florida Educational FCU often hosts workshops, webinars, and seminars that focus on enhancing financial knowledge. These events provide practical insights and allow participants to engage with financial experts who can answer their questions directly. For those who prefer self-study, the credit union may also provide access to online courses that cover essential financial topics at their own pace.
For personalized assistance, members can take advantage of consultations with financial advisors who can tailor guidance to their specific circumstances. Overall, South Florida Educational FCU is committed to empowering its members through comprehensive financial education resources, fostering a well-informed community capable of making sound financial choices. More information about these resources can typically be found on their website.
